Mathews man dies after falling in water

The Mathews Sheriff’s Office, along with members of the county’s fire department and rescue squad, responded to a man overboard in the 200 block of Marina Road in North shortly after 11 a.m. Sunday.

The victim, James Watts III, 78, of North, was recovered from Greenmansion Cove and pronounced deceased by Mathews Volunteer Rescue Squad, according to Major J.T. Williams of the sheriff’s office.

Richmond residents who were boating in an 8’ inflatable water craft in the vicinity of Mobjack Marina reported seeing the victim on his dock and waving to him as they went by, said Williams. They then saw him fall into the water and were able to get to him and drag him to shore, where they performed CPR but were unable to revive him.

Williams said the cause of death could have been an underlying medical condition. The body was taken to the medical examiner’s office in Norfolk by Foster-Faulkner Funeral Home to determine cause of death. ...
